  "MatterEXText5": "When the demand for emergency medical services exceeds the availability of in-service ambulances, the Fire Department’s Bureau of Emergency Medical Services (FDNY-EMS) triages emergency medical calls in order to dispatch ambulances to the most critical medical emergencies.  As a result, there can be a queue of emergency medical runs awaiting dispatch for when an ambulance becomes available. This bill would require that New York City Emergency Management (NYCEM) issue emergency notifications each time FDNY-EMS has more than 25 pending ambulance dispatches at any given time. Such notification would include information on non-emergency room resources for medical care and consideration of when individuals should seek alternative means of transportation to an emergency room.",
